Trans-dānŭbĭānus (-dānŭvĭā-nus ), a, um, adj. Danubius,
I.situated beyond the Danube, Transdanubian: “Dacia,Vop. Aur. 39, 7: “regio,Liv. 40, 58, 8 (dub.; al. Aquiloniam regionem).—In plur. subst.: ‡ Transdānŭbĭāni , ōrum, m., the nations beyond the Danube, Inscr. Orell. 750.
